In a recent work the author presented a numerical solution for a neutral pionlike particle in spinor-connection theory. Here, using a more analytical approach and an improved numerical method, that solution is studied in greater and refining detail. A new solution for an electrically charged pionlike particle is also given. The results obtained suggest that the electromagnetic and strong-field coupling constants are closely equal.
